Bahrain vs Belgium: tax rates compared
Between the two, Belgium's income tax rate (52.7%) tops Bahrain's (0%) by 52.7pp. The 200-country average is 28%: Bahrain sits below it, Belgium sits above it. Bahrain's figure is dated 2026-01-11 and Belgium's 2025-01-01, so the two rates come from different data vintages.
Verified data covers six of the six tracked tax types for both countries; every rate below is cited to its source and dated.
At a glance
| Tax | BH | BE | Difference |
|---|---|---|---|
| Income Tax | 0% | 52.7% | BE +52.7 pplargest gap |
| Corporate Tax | 0% | 25% | BE +25 pp |
| VAT | 10% | 21% | BE +11 pp |
| Capital Gains Tax | 0% | 10% | BE +10 pp |
| Crypto Tax | 0% | 10% | BE +10 pp |
| Wealth Tax | 0% | 0% | match |

Corporate Tax
| Country | Rate | Source |
|---|---|---|
| Bahrain | 0% | Source: Tax Foundation — Worldwide Corporate Tax Rates · as of 2025-01-01 |
| Belgium | 25% | Source: Tax Foundation — Worldwide Corporate Tax Rates · as of 2025-01-01 |
| Difference | −25 pp | Belgium higher |
Between the two, Belgium's corporate tax rate (25%) tops Bahrain's (0%) by 25pp. The 201-country average is 22.6%: Bahrain sits below it, Belgium sits above it.
VAT
| Country | Rate | Source |
|---|---|---|
| Bahrain | 10% | Source: PWC Worldwide Tax Summaries — Bahrain (Corporate, Other taxes) · as of 2026-01-11 |
| Belgium | 21% | Source: PWC Worldwide Tax Summaries — Belgium (Corporate, Other taxes) · as of 2026-02-13 |
| Difference | −11 pp | Belgium higher |
Between the two, Belgium's VAT rate (21%) tops Bahrain's (10%) by 11pp. The 181-country average is 15%: Bahrain sits below it, Belgium sits above it.
Capital Gains Tax
| Country | Rate | Source |
|---|---|---|
| Bahrain | 0% | Source: PWC Worldwide Tax Summaries — Bahrain (Individual, Income determination) · as of 2026-01-11 |
| Belgium | 10% | Source: KPMG TaxNewsFlash — Belgium: New capital gains tax approved by Parliament · as of 2026-01-01 |
| Difference | −10 pp | Belgium higher |
Between the two, Belgium's capital gains tax rate (10%) tops Bahrain's (0%) by 10pp. The 175-country average is 10.3%: both sit below it.
